WebOct 5, 2024 · A townhouse (also called a townhome) is generally one unit with at least two floors in a row of many that shares either one or two walls with another unit next to it. It … WebThe term townhouse is currently [when?] coming into wider use in the UK, but terraced house (not "terraced home") is more common. Shophouse: the name given in Southeast Asia to a terraced two to five story urban building featuring a shop or other public activity on the street level, with residential accommodation on upper floors.
